Watch the best of the action from the first ever women's skiing slopestyle event at the 2014 Winter Olympics in Sochi.
The event was won by Canadian 19-year-old Dara Howell with a final score of 94.20 seconds.
Great Britain's Katie Summerhayes crashed out in her first run, before posting a score of 70.60 which resulted in a seventh place finish.
